2024 ISK to ALL Performance & Market Timing Review

Analysis of key historical highlights and timing insights for 2024

During 2024, the ISK to ALL exchange rate experienced significant fluctuation. The market reached its absolute peak on January 21, valuing the pair at 0.7055. Conversely, the yearly low was recorded on September 4, dropping to 0.6494.

This high-to-low spread represents a total annual volatility of 0.0561 ALL. From a start-to-finish perspective, comparing the January average rate of 0.6954 to the December average rate of 0.6766, the exchange rate registered a net change of -2.70% (reflecting a weakening trend).

Looking at year-over-year peak valuations, the 2024 high of 0.7055 was down 9.19% compared to the 2023 peak of 0.7769, indicating shifts in long-term support levels.

ISK to ALL Seasonal Trends & Volatility Analysis

A structured review of seasonal halves, trading extremes, consecutive streaks, and historical baselines.

Seasonal Halves (H1 vs H2)

Seasonal

The average exchange rate in the first half of the year (H1: Jan–Jun) was 0.6841, compared to 0.6650 in the second half (H2: Jul–Dec). This shows that the rate was stronger in the first half (Jan–Jun) by a margin of 0.0191 points.

H1 Avg (Jan–Jun) 0.6841
H2 Avg (Jul–Dec) 0.6650

Volatility Range Comparison

Volatility

The most volatile month in 2024 was November, with a trading range of 0.0261 ALL (High: 0.6816 / Low: 0.6555). On the other end, July was the most stable month, with a tight range of 0.0070 ALL (High: 0.6752 / Low: 0.6681).

November Spread (Volatile) ±0.0261
July Spread (Stable) ±0.0070

Monthly Breakdown

Statistical summary for each calendar month.

Month High Low Average
January 0.7055 0.6839 0.6954
February 0.7044 0.6933 0.6985
March 0.7004 0.6836 0.6934
April 0.6857 0.6676 0.6747
May 0.6801 0.6660 0.6701
June 0.6760 0.6652 0.6725
July 0.6752 0.6681 0.6715
August 0.6674 0.6502 0.6587
September 0.6584 0.6494 0.6534
October 0.6659 0.6564 0.6617
November 0.6816 0.6555 0.6683
December 0.6827 0.6704 0.6766
